    What is a Ball valve and how does it work

     

    A ball valve is a type of valve that uses a spherical disc to control the flow of fluid through it. It is opened by rotating the disc so that the hole it contains lines up with the passageway in the valve body and closed by returning the disc to its original position. Ball valves are durable, reliable, and easy to use which makes them a popular choice for many applications.

    The ball is usually connected to a handle on the outside of the valve, which can be turned to open or close the valve. Ball valves are used in a variety of applications, including plumbing, industrial piping, and automotive engineering.

    When the handle is turned to the open position, the ball is rotated so that a hole in the center of the ball aligns with the flow of fluid. This allows fluid to pass through the valve and into the piping system. When the handle is turned to the closed position, the ball is rotated so that the hole in the center of the ball is blocked off. This prevents fluid from flowing through the valve. Ball valves are designed to be very durable and can withstand a high amount of pressure. They are also relatively easy to maintain and repair.
